ob.el: Reintroduce ":results org" but using "#+BEGIN_SRC org", not "#+BEGIN_ORG"

* ob.el (org-babel-common-header-args-w-values)
(org-babel-insert-result): Reintroduce ":results org" but
using "#+BEGIN_SRC org", not "#+BEGIN_ORG".

* org.texi (results): Update documentation for ":results
drawer" and ":results org".

@ -13660,10 +13660,14 @@ buffer as quoted text. E.g., @code{:results value verbatim}.
@item @code{file}
The results will be interpreted as the path to a file, and will be inserted
into the Org mode buffer as a file link. E.g., @code{:results value file}.
@item @code{raw}, @code{org}
@item @code{raw}
The results are interpreted as raw Org mode code and are inserted directly
into the buffer. If the results look like a table they will be aligned as
such by Org mode. E.g., @code{:results value raw}.
@item @code{org}
The results are will be enclosed in a @code{BEGIN_SRC org} block.
They are not comma-escaped by default but they will be if you hit @kbd{TAB}
in the block and/or if you export the file. E.g., @code{:results value org}.
@item @code{html}
Results are assumed to be HTML and will be enclosed in a @code{BEGIN_HTML}
block. E.g., @code{:results value html}.
@ -13677,7 +13681,7 @@ E.g., @code{:results value code}.
The result is converted to pretty-printed code and is enclosed in a code
block. This option currently supports Emacs Lisp, Python, and Ruby. E.g.,
@code{:results value pp}.
@item @code{wrap}
@item @code{drawer}
The result is wrapped in a RESULTS drawer. This can be useful for
inserting @code{raw} or @code{org} syntax results in such a way that their
extent is known and they can be automatically removed or replaced.
